Indian Gaming; Approval by Operation of Law of the Addendum to Tribal-State Compact for Control of Class III Blackjack on the Lower Sioux Community Reservation in the State of Minnesota for Class III Card Games

Notice.

📖 Research Context From Federal Register API

Summary:

This notice announces the approval by operation of law of the Addendum to Tribal-State Compact for Control of Class III Blackjack on the Lower Sioux Community Reservation in the State of Minnesota for Class III Card Games (Amendment) governing the operation and regulation of class III gaming activities.

Key Dates
Citation: 90 FR 58049
The amendment takes effect on December 15, 2025.
